首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--软件工程论文

敏捷开发在软件开发中的应用研究

摘要第1-5页
Abstract第5-9页
第一章 引言第9-15页
   ·课题研究的背景和意义第9-10页
   ·国内外研究现状第10-13页
   ·本课题来源及所作的主要工作第13-14页
   ·本文组织结构第14-15页
第二章 敏捷开发内容介绍第15-32页
   ·敏捷开发——价值观和表现特征第15-19页
     ·敏捷开发的价值观第15-17页
     ·敏捷开发的特征第17-19页
   ·敏捷开发——使用迭代式开发方法第19-24页
     ·迭代开发的定义第20-21页
     ·迭代开发的优点第21-23页
     ·迭代开发的策略和阶段第23-24页
   ·敏捷开发——类的设计原则第24-28页
     ·单一职责原则SRP:Single Responsibility Principle第24-25页
     ·开放封闭原则OCP:Open-Close Principle第25-26页
     ·Liskov 替换原则LSP:Liskov Substitution Principle第26页
     ·依赖倒置原则DIP:Dependency Inversion Principle第26-27页
     ·接口隔离原则ISP:Interface Separate Principle第27-28页
   ·敏捷开发——类的设计模式第28页
   ·敏捷开发——组件的设计原则第28-32页
     ·包和组件第28-29页
     ·组件的内聚性原则:粒度第29-30页
     ·组件的耦合性原则:稳定性第30-32页
第三章 化学计量学软件介绍与需求分析第32-35页
   ·相关背景知识介绍第32-34页
     ·化学计量学第32页
     ·化学计量学软件第32页
     ·开发化学计量学软件采用的技术路线第32-34页
   ·化学计量学软件的需求分析第34-35页
     ·系统目标和功能描述第34页
     ·化学计量学软件需求描述第34-35页
第四章 化学计量学软件的设计与实现第35-62页
   ·第一次迭代——样品集功能模块的实现第36-45页
     ·样品集模块的功能分解与类实现第37-39页
     ·样品集模块的组件和类的分配关系第39-43页
     ·系统用户界面GUI 的实现——样品集模块第43-45页
     ·样品集功能模块测试第45页
   ·第二次迭代——定量校正功能模块的实现第45-53页
     ·定量校正模块的功能分解第46-49页
     ·定量校正模块的组件和类的分配关系第49-51页
     ·系统用户界面GUI 的实现——定量校正功能模块第51-52页
     ·定量校正功能模块测试第52-53页
   ·第三次迭代——产品模功能模块的实现第53-57页
     ·产品模模块的功能分解第53-54页
     ·产品模功能模块的组件和类的分配关系第54-56页
     ·系统用户界面GUI 的实现——样品集功能模块第56-57页
     ·产品模功能模块测试第57页
   ·软件总体功能实现第57-60页
     ·系统用户界面GUI 的实现——工作台第57-58页
     ·软件整体流程图第58-59页
     ·软件总体结构第59-60页
   ·各次迭代开发的小结第60-62页
第五章 软件测试及测试结果分析第62-67页
   ·软件测试第62-66页
     ·单元测试第62页
     ·集成测试第62-63页
     ·系统测试第63-66页
     ·验收测试第66页
   ·测试结果分析第66-67页
第六章 总结与展望第67-69页
参考文献第69-73页
致谢第73-74页
攻读硕士期间取得的研究成果第74-75页

论文共75页,点击 下载论文
上一篇:一种微惯性跟踪设备的研制
下一篇:抗几何攻击的数字图像水印研究